Programme Overview

The Certificate in Mathematical Physics Problem Solving is designed for students and professionals with a strong interest in the intersection of mathematics and physics. This program equips learners with a robust foundation in analytical and problem-solving techniques, tailored to the rigorous demands of mathematical physics. It covers essential topics such as advanced calculus, differential equations, linear algebra, and quantum mechanics, alongside computational methods and theoretical physics. Participants will delve into the application of mathematical concepts to physical systems, enhancing their ability to model and solve real-world problems.

Learners will develop key skills in mathematical modeling, statistical analysis, and computational physics, enabling them to tackle complex problems in both academic and industrial settings. The program fosters a deep understanding of theoretical frameworks and practical applications, preparing students to apply advanced mathematical techniques to physical phenomena. Students will also enhance their proficiency in programming languages relevant to physics research, such as Python and MATLAB, and gain experience using advanced software tools for simulations and data analysis.

Topics Covered

  1. Linear Algebra Fundamentals: Covers vector spaces, linear transformations, and matrix theory.: Differential Equations: Explores ordinary and partial differential equations and their applications.
  2. Complex Analysis: Focuses on complex numbers, functions, and integrals.: Quantum Mechanics Basics: Introduces wave mechanics, Schrödinger equation, and quantum states.
  3. Statistical Mechanics: Discusses thermodynamics, ensembles, and phase transitions.: Numerical Methods: Teaches computational techniques for solving mathematical physics problems.
